  1. All That Jazz is a 1979 American musical drama film directed by Bob Fosse and starring Roy Scheider. The screenplay, by Robert Alan Aurthur and Fosse, is a semi-autobiographical fantasy based on aspects of Fosse's life and career as a dancer, choreographer and director.

Aug 19, 2020 · Famed choreographer Bob Fosse's fourth film as a director, the semi-autobiographical All That Jazz, (1979) was inspired by his drug use, womanizing and near-fatal heart attack, as well as the Hilma Wolitzer novel about death, Ending. The screenplay was cowritten with Robert Alan Aurthur, who died of lung cancer during the project.
